From daae24ca889aab549241762714d50a5ae73fa51f Mon Sep 17 00:00:00 2001 From: "dependabot[bot]" <49699333+dependabot[bot]@users.noreply.github.com> Date: Sat, 13 Jun 2026 02:32:30 +0000 Subject: [PATCH] chore(deps): bump wasm-encoder from 0.251.0 to 0.252.0 Bumps [wasm-encoder](https://github.com/bytecodealliance/wasm-tools) from 0.251.0 to 0.252.0. - [Release notes](https://github.com/bytecodealliance/wasm-tools/releases) - [Commits](https://github.com/bytecodealliance/wasm-tools/commits) --- updated-dependencies: - dependency-name: wasm-encoder dependency-version: 0.252.0 dependency-type: direct:production update-type: version-update:semver-minor ... Signed-off-by: dependabot[bot] --- Cargo.lock | 23 +++++++++++++++++------ crates/typed-wasm-codegen/Cargo.toml | 2 +- crates/typed-wasm-verify/Cargo.toml | 2 +- 3 files changed, 19 insertions(+), 8 deletions(-) diff --git a/Cargo.lock b/Cargo.lock index 0c61a30..f1e8c74 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-154,7 +154,7 @@ version = "0.1.0" dependencies = [ "typed-wasm-verify", "wasm-encoder", - "wasmparser", + "wasmparser 0.251.0", "wasmprinter", ] @@ -164,7 +164,7 @@ version = "0.1.0" dependencies = [ "thiserror", "wasm-encoder", - "wasmparser", + "wasmparser 0.251.0", ] [[package]] @@ -175,12 +175,12 @@ checksum = "e6e4313cd5fcd3dad5cafa179702e2b244f760991f45397d14d4ebf38247da75" [[package]] name = "wasm-encoder" -version = "0.251.0" +version = "0.252.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"5a879a421bd17c528b74721b2abf4c62e8f1d1889c2ba8c3c50d02deaf2ce395" +checksum = "8185ae345fa5687c054626ff9a50e7089797a343d9904d1dc9820eb4c4d3196f" dependencies = [ "leb128fmt", - "wasmparser", + "wasmparser 0.252.0", ] [[package]] @@ -196,6 +196,17 @@ dependencies = [ "serde", ] +[[package]] +name = "wasmparser" +version = "0.252.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"d3eb099dcadcde5be9eef55e3a337128efd4e44b4c93122487e4d2e4e1c6627c" +dependencies = [ + "bitflags", + "indexmap", + "semver", +] + [[package]] name = "wasmprinter" version = "0.251.0" @@ -204,7 +215,7 @@ checksum = "8798c1a699bd25648b6708eefe94d97c6f9891febb94b42cca1f7a4b086ea64e" dependencies = [ "anyhow", "termcolor", - "wasmparser", + "wasmparser 0.251.0", ] [[package]] diff --git a/crates/typed-wasm-codegen/Cargo.toml b/crates/typed-wasm-codegen/Cargo.toml index 46c744f..0ce57fc 100644 --- a/crates/typed-wasm-codegen/Cargo.toml +++ b/crates/typed-wasm-codegen/Cargo.toml @@ -19,7 +19,7 @@ path = "src/bin/tw.rs" # Pinned to match typed-wasm-verify's wasmparser line exactly; the wasm # tooling 0.x series ships API breaks on minor bumps, so keep producer # and verifier on the same locked version. -wasm-encoder = "=0.251.0" +wasm-encoder = "=0.252.0" # WAT (text wasm) rendering for `tw build --emit wat` (Phase 1 deliverable 4, #125). wasmprinter = "=0.251.0" # The producer reuses the verifier's own carrier encoders so the emitted diff --git a/crates/typed-wasm-verify/Cargo.toml b/crates/typed-wasm-verify/Cargo.toml index af7238b..b35bbcd 100644 --- a/crates/typed-wasm-verify/Cargo.toml +++ b/crates/typed-wasm-verify/Cargo.toml @@ -40,4 +40,4 @@ wasmparser = "=0.251.0" thiserror = "2" [dev-dependencies] -wasm-encoder = "=0.251.0" +wasm-encoder = "=0.252.0"